The Collateral Consequences Of An Criminal Conviction
The effects of a Criminal conviction can be devastating. Even if a person is to receive Probation with no Jail, or a small Jail or Prison sentence, after they are released there will be lifelong effects on the Defendant. This can involve Lifetime Probation; job restrictions; apartment/dormitory restrictions or prohibitions; Professional Licenses being Revoked; loss or severe restriction of internet privileges; etc. Check the link below for information regarding what Collateral Consequences you or a loved one might be facing.

Mitigation
When it comes to “Mitigation” regarding a charge of Criminal, it is important to start that process right away. Not only can this help us with potentially convincing a Prosecutor to not file charges in the first place, but it may reduce the level of charges that they ultimately file. In addition, if there is a conviction later, this can be used to help reduce any type of Sentence if there is a “Range.” The Mitigating Factors which are considered by both the Prosecutor and the Courts includes Statutory and Non-Statutory elements.
Many items that we routinely include in our Mitigation Packages include Psychosexual Risk Evaluations; Polygraphs; Neuro-Psychological Evaluations; Counseling records; substance abuse Treatment and/or Rehabilitation; and a complete history of a person’s background. This can include Individualized Education Plans (IEPs), medical records, Counseling records, etc. Lastly. we often include what’s known as a “Proportionality Review/Sentencing Disparity” analysis in which we can show the Prosecutor and Court that similarly-situated Defendants received low Sentences.
